We are deeply grateful to the State of Florida for its continued investment in public education through the State of Florida’s School District Education Foundation Matching Grant. As part of a $7 million statewide appropriation, our foundation has been awarded $147,296.45 to match private dollars 1:1 raised locally—doubling the impact of community support for Seminole County Public Schools.
These matching funds will support the following Foundation programs:
- Tools 4 Seminole Schools
- Grants 4 Great Ideas
- Seminole Resilient Community Project
- Environmental Studies Center / MudWalk
The State of Florida’s School District Education Foundation Matching Grant, facilitated by the Consortium of Florida Education Foundations, is a powerful example of how public-private partnerships strengthen local education. While the Consortium administers the program, the State of Florida is the source of the funding, ensuring that private contributions raised in our community go twice as far in supporting students, teachers, and classrooms.
For more than 20 years, this Matching Grant program has provided a dollar-for-dollar incentive for local education foundations to raise private contributions for eligible projects. Since its inception, the program has generated more than $173 million in combined state and private funding, supporting initiatives that:

- Serve students across Florida
- Promote literacy
- Encourage STEM and career and technical education
- Increase classroom innovation
- Support teachers
- Improve graduation rates
The Consortium of Florida Education Foundations, established in 1987, is the statewide membership organization for school district-wide local education foundations. It connects individuals, organizations, and financial resources to strengthen local foundations and advance student success throughout Florida.
In the most recent year alone, the School District Education Foundation 1:1 Matching Grant program:
- Generated a total investment of $17,574,275
- Matched $7 million in state funds with over $10 million in private-sector investment
- Supported 109 projects across 60 school districts
- Served 99% of Florida’s K–12 public school students
